Cliff Stoll - The Cuckoo's Egg - Finished - 3/6/2009
PB-Cliff Stoll is an astronomer who has been ÒrecycledÓ to Keck Observatory at Lawrence Berkley Lab computer center. Now and aside Ð this a mystery, but it is also a true story. They time is 1987 and the early days of the internet and Cliff is tasked in his new position to reconcile a .75 cent difference in the accounting procedures for charging for computer time. This simple request turns into a year long search across time zones and countries for a computer hacker who has gotten into the computers at Berkley Lab and has Cliff discovers computers at may military, university and private companies across the country. It is a tale of the beginning of the internet and at the time there was very little known or practiced in the area of security. Cliff eventually contacted numerous government agencies from the CIA to NSA, Military security and the FBI and mostly they just brushed the off with the comment that it wasnÕt their problem. Its an interesting book, especially looking back for 30 years in the future.
